Fiji men’s basketball team thrashes Vanuatu 123-61 in FIBA Melanesian Cup match

The Fiji men’s basketball team secured a commanding 123-61 victory over Vanuatu at the FIBA Melanesian Cup today.

Tyrone McLennan finished the game with a competition-high 44 points, including an impressive seven three-pointers.

Speaking during the post match interview, McLennan said the team played with a lot of energy, they came out really hot to start the game, and it was a lot of fun with the boys.

McLennan says their coach had given several players the green light to shoot in the last two games, where he made the most of the opportunity.

He says fellow teammate Josh Fox came close to a double-double, showcasing solid defence alongside McLennan's offensive firepower.

Looking ahead to their next challenge, McLennan says the team will use their rest day to prepare for the crucial do-or-die match against New Caledonia at 1.30pm this Friday.
